An utopia is an assumed community or society that maintains highly beneficial or nearly perfect conditions for its citizens. The opposition of a utopia is a dystopia. One could also say that a utopia is an ideal place that has been planned so there are no problems. In many cultures, societies, and religions, there is some story or fantasy of a different past when humankind lived in a modest and simplistic state, but at the same time one of perfect happiness and fulfillment.
